Rural Renewable Energy Agency Boss Outlines Major Achievements for 2025

MONROVIA, LIBERIA-The Executive Director of the Rural Renewable Energy Agency (RREA), Samuel Nagbe, has outlined key achievements for 2025.

Director Nagbe named effective communication, inter-government partnership, and the launch of the Battery Energy Storage Project in Lofa County as some areas of intervention.

The RREA Executive Director listed Buchanan, Barclayville, as some local capitals that are experiencing real-time energy supply.

Speaking on the “Super Morning Show” on Friday, January 2, 2026, Nagbe revealed that the road pavement of the 9.35-megawatt power from the Gbedin dam is being carried out.

He thanked the Office of the Vice President, Public Works, and the Ministry of Finance for their collaboration over the year.

At the same time, the Executive Director of the RREA said the entity is partnering with Energy Companies to provide jobs for Liberians.

According to him, the outcome has been fruitful over the year, where local Liberian entrepreneurs have been empowered.
